Solar Water Heater Replacement Questions
What are signs that a solar water heater needs replacement? Common signs include reduced hot water supply, leaks, corrosion, or outdated system components.
How does replacing a solar water heater improve property efficiency? A new system can provide more reliable hot water and reduce energy consumption for heating water.
What types of solar water heaters are available for replacement? Options include active and passive systems, with variations suitable for different property sizes and needs.
Is replacement necessary if the current system is still functioning? Replacement may be considered if the system is inefficient, costly to repair, or no longer meets household demands.
